SS-31 – the mitochondrial peptide

SS-31, also known as Elamipretide, is a mitochondria-targeted peptide designed to protect and restore mitochondrial function at its most critical point. Unlike peptides that influence hormones or signaling upstream, SS-31 acts directly inside the mitochondria, the structures responsible for producing cellular energy. GHK-Cu – more than a beauty tool

GHK-Cu is one of the most remarkable bioactive peptides ever discovered, a naturally occurring copper complex found in human plasma, saliva, and urine that plays a major role in tissue repair, collagen synthesis, and overall cellular regeneration. IGF-1 LR3 VS IGF-1 DES

Insulin-like Growth Factor 1 (IGF-1) is a peptide hormone that plays a crucial role in muscle growth, recovery, and cellular repair. In the world of enhancement and bodybuilding, two forms of IGF-1 are particularly popular: IGF-1 LR3 (Long Arg3 IGF-1) and IGF-1 DES (1-3 IGF-1). Cardarine – exercise in a pill

Cardarine, also known as GW-501516, is a peroxisome proliferator-activated receptor delta (PPAR-δ) agonist initially developed to treat metabolic and cardiovascular diseases. Over time, it gained immense popularity in the fitness and bodybuilding communities for its ability to enhance endurance, improve fat metabolism, and aid in achieving a lean, defined physique. ACE-031 for myostatin inhibition

ACE-031 is synthetic peptide that acts as an inhibitor of myostatin, the protein that naturally regulates muscle growth in the body. This peptide, developed by the biopharmaceutical company Acceleron Pharma, was originally researched for treating muscle-wasting conditions such as muscular dystrophy.
